Body
Origins and Family
Raymond V, Count of Toulouse was born on January 1, 1134[2]. His father was Alphonse Jourdain[9]. His mother was Faydide d'Uzès[10].
Career and Affiliations
Raymond V, Count of Toulouse worked as an aristocrat[5].
Personal Life
Among Raymond V, Count of Toulouse's spouses was Constance of France, Countess of Toulouse[11]. Children include Raymond VI, Count of Toulouse[12], a troubadour[27], 1156–1222[28], of County of Toulouse[29]; Albéric Taillefer de Toulouse[13], a feudatory[30], 1157–1183[31], of France[32]; Azalais of Toulouse[14], an aristocrat[33], 1200–1200[34], of France[35]; and Balduin of Toulouse[15], an aristocrat[36], 1165–1214[37], of France[38].
Death and Burial
Recorded date of death include January 1, 1194[4] and December 1194[7]. Raymond V, Count of Toulouse died in Nîmes[3]. Burial took place at Nîmes Cathedral[8].
